Is there a ferry from Algeciras to Ceuta?

The ferry route from Algeciras to Ceuta is operated by Baleària, Trasmediterránea, and FRS Iberia, with many daily crossings all year long. Specifically, usually, there are 12 Algeciras - Ceuta ferries from FRS Iberia, 8 from Baleària and 5 from Trasmediterránea.

How long is the ferry ride from Algeciras to Ceuta?

The duration of the ferry trip from Algeciras to Ceuta is from 1 hr to 1.5 hr. Travel time depends on the company and the type of ferry. 

Is there a high-speed ferry from Algeciras to Ceuta?

Yes, there are high-speed ferries from Algeciras to Ceuta. The fastest ferry to Ceuta takes 1 hr to reach the port in North Africa. 

How much is the ferry from Algeciras to Ceuta?

The Algeciras - Ceuta ferry cost ranges from €30 to €45.  Keep in mind that the Algeciras to Ceuta ferry prices can fluctuate based on discounts, seat type or vehicle selection.

What’s the ferry schedule from Algeciras to Ceuta?

There are normally 10 to 14 daily ferry routes from the port of Algeciras in the Iberian peninsula to the port of Ceuta in North Africa. 

The earliest ferry usually departs at 07:00 and arrives in Ceuta at 08:00. The latest crossing from Algeciras is around 22:00, reaching Ceuta around 23:30.

What’s the distance between Algeciras and Ceuta?

The distance between the port of Algeciras and the port of Ceuta is approximately 15 nautical miles (28 km).

Useful tips for your ferry trip from Algeciras to Ceuta

Here are some travel tips for your trip from Algeciras to Ceuta:

  • We recommend arriving at the port of Algeciras at least 1h before departure. During the high season, in particular, the port can get quite busy.
  • Ceuta is a beautiful, multicultural city that combines Arab and Spanish influences. We suggest walking around its old town and exploring its markets. Read our Ceuta travel guide for more information and useful tips about the autonomous city in North Africa. 
  • Ceuta enjoys reduced taxation and it is considered a duty-free zone, so it's also perfect for a shopping trip.
  • Another way of reaching the Spanish exclave is by taking a ferry from Gibraltar to Ceuta. 
  • From Ceuta, you can also easily travel to Morocco so make sure to have your passport with you. 
  • The city of Algeciras, Spain, is a perfect getaway to North Africa. For example, an interesting route that you could consider is from Algeciras to Tangier, to explore the beauties of the Moroccan city.
  • The Algeciras - Ceuta day trip is a pretty popular idea as in just 1 hour you can visit the impressive Spanish exclave.

Where to take the ferry from Algeciras to Ceuta

The port of Algeciras in Spain is located in the province of Cádiz, close to Gibraltar. The port of Algeciras is situated in the city center and it's easily accessible on foot or by public transport.

It's also 30 min drive or 1.5 hrs by public transport from the airport of Gibraltar. 

Tip: if you decide to travel with FRS ferries, keep in mind that they offer a free bus service connecting the ports of Algeciras and Tarifa.

Can I travel on the ferry from Algeciras to Ceuta with a car?

Yes, there is the option of traveling on board with your vehicle. The Algeciras - Ceuta ferry prices for cars are from €65 to €70, while for motorcycles around €25. Bear in mind that tickets for the car ferry deck may run out fast, so we suggest that you book your car or motorbike ticket well in advance!

Ferry luggage

Each ferry company has its own baggage allowance policy. In Baleària ferries you can carry the maximum luggage that you can get on board by yourself, without help and in one go. Ferries might also have open luggage trunks in the passenger lounges, where you can leave your luggage during the trip. Trasmediterránea allows passengers a maximum of 40 kg of luggage for cabins and 30 kg for seats, while ferries often have closed luggage storage rooms. FRS allows passengers to take their luggage on board free of charge.
